Elementary School in Lawrenceville Briefly Evacuated Due to Odor of Smoke

No fire was found.

Students and staffΒ at Freeman's Mill Elementary on Old Peachtree Road briefly evacuated the building Tuesday morning, Oct. 8,Β after an odor of smoke was detected near the cafeteria.

Fire personnel from Station 18Β in HoschtonΒ and Station 27Β in DaculaΒ were among the units responding to the call.

Gwinnett County Public Schools spokesperson Sloan Roach said students and staff were out of the school for approximately 30 minutes while fire crews attempted to determine the origin of the smoke odor.

"They determined everything was okay," Roach said.Β "It appears the smoke may have come from an air conditioning unit on top of the school."

The students returned to class at 11:50 a.m.
